Output 6bd331bda4ff0e540cdffb7a9c5d0f2395b87baaf0581598d6f15b1c0007aa4a:0

value
24477854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bb4795ac888867115d6946a9f22a87badadea96 OP_EQUAL
address
3FtJrqJqWgFe9PKLZ8dAUg7x3a5CNPaA4b
transaction
6bd331bda4ff0e540cdffb7a9c5d0f2395b87baaf0581598d6f15b1c0007aa4a
spent
true